Ontario Normal School Manuals: Science of Education offers a fascinating glimpse into the foundations of teacher training and pedagogical thought. Originally prepared by the Ontario Ministry of Education, this historical text delves into the science underpinning effective teaching methods. Exploring key principles of child development and educational psychology, the manual examines the theoretical frameworks that shaped instructional practices of the era.

A valuable resource for anyone interested in the history of education, this book provides insight into the psychological considerations that informed pedagogical approaches. It covers a range of topics relevant to understanding how children learn and how educators can best facilitate that learning process.
